236: A Powerful Outlet in Ink

Join Paris and she welcomes special guest Colleen Sharlow, a Prevention Educator, Mental Health Advocate, creative writer and Cat Mom.


Colleen shares her journey with bipolar, starting from her childhood in a large family where mental health was seldom discussed, through her misdiagnosis with depression, struggles with an eating disorder and eventual diagnosis with bipolar I after a frightening episode of mania and psychosis.


She recounts how writing, family support and therapy became essential tools in her recovery. The episode also highlights Colleen's work as a prevention educator, her efforts to support students and her advice for others living with bipolar.
